@ObsoleteOddity
@ObsoleteOddity 4 ай бұрын
Yes, it’s very difficult these days, because the younger generation are not really collecting anything. And so with each generation there is less and less interesting stuff that ends up in thrift stores. Plus with the Internet, a lot of the thrift store managers and owners are selling directly online. This has impacted the market massively. The same goes for the people who would’ve previously taken unwanted items to a thrift store, they now try and sell it online. @kandipiatkowski8589
@kandipiatkowski8589 4 ай бұрын
I collect car models. Probably the only way I can own my favorite car....the Duesenberg. Despite the foreign sounding name, the car is American. Interesting car.....almost all of the chassis were made in 1927, then all the bodies were custom made from 1927 thru the late 30s. I have a special one, called a Twenty Grand.....that's how much it cost in the 1930s.
